“…[1]Borametallocenophanes comprising a three coordinate bridging boron centre have been reported for a variety of transition metals from group 4 [1][2][3][4][5], 5 [6], 6 [7] and 8 [8,9]. These compounds have attracted considerable interest [10,11], since corresponding [1]borazirconocenophanes constitute active catalysts for the polymerization of olefins [1][2][3][4][5]12] and the highly strained [1]boraferrocenophanes proved their propensity to undergo ring-opening polymerization yielding poly(ferrocenyl)boranes [8,9,13].…”

“…Since Kaminsky and co-workers [1,2] discovered metallocenes bridging with Si atom between ligands as cyclopentadienyl (Cp) for the catalysis of polymerization in 1980, ansa-metallocenes of the early transition metals have attracted attention for homogeneous catalysis. Recently, the reactivity and the structures of ansa-metallocenes with several bridging atoms or groups were studied experimentally [3][4][5][6][7][8][9][10][11][12][13][14]. In our previous paper [15], the structures and the energies of the initial reaction of ethylene polymerization for the Ziegler-Natta catalysis with eight bridging groups of Cp ligands were studied by an ab initio MO and a density functional method.…”
